Julie Dolan Medal


The Julie Dolan Medal is awarded annually to the player voted to be the best player in the highest women's soccer league in Australia. The medal has been presented to players in the W-League and previously in the Women's National Soccer League. The medal is named after former Matilda's Captain and soccer administrator Julie Dolan. The format was changed for the 2015–16 season, with a panel featuring former players, media, referees and technical staff, who voted on each regular-season match.
Since 2016 the award has been presented jointly with the Johnny Warren Medal at an event known as the Warren – Dolan Awards, where both A-League and W-League/A-League Women awards are presented.

Winners

A-League Women

YearWinnerClub
2008–09Lana HarchQueensland Roar
2009Michelle HeymanCentral Coast Mariners
2010–11Kyah SimonSydney FC
2011–12Sally ShipardCanberra United
2012–13Clare PolkinghorneBrisbane Roar
2013–14Tameka ButtBrisbane Roar
2014Emily van EgmondNewcastle Jets
2015–16Ashleigh SykesCanberra United
2016–17Sam KerrPerth Glory

2018–19Christine NairnMelbourne Victory
2019–20Kristen HamiltonWestern Sydney Wanderers
2020–21Michelle HeymanCanberra United
2021–22Fiona WortsAdelaide United
2022–23Alex ChidiacMelbourne Victory
2023–24Sophie HardingWestern Sydney Wanderers
2024–25Alex ChidiacMelbourne Victory
